Key Trends Shaping the Online Casino Industry
The online gambling sector is dynamic, with several trends influencing its trajectory. Understanding these trends is essential for operators, investors, and players alike.
- Mobile Gaming Dominance: With smartphones becoming ubiquitous, mobile casino games have surged in popularity, offering convenience and accessibility.
- Live Dealer Games: Bridging the gap between physical and virtual casinos, live dealer games provide real-time interaction and authenticity.
- Cryptocurrency Payments: The adoption of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um facilitates faster, secure, and anonymous transactions.
- Regulatory Evolution: Governments worldwide are updating legislation to better regulate online gambling, impacting market entry and player protection.
- Personalized Gaming Experiences: AI-driven customization tailors game recommendations and promotions to individual player preferences.
Challenges Facing Online Casinos Today
Despite the promising growth, the industry faces several hurdles that require strategic solutions.
- Regulatory Compliance: Navigating diverse legal frameworks across countries can be complex and costly.
- Security Concerns: Cybersecurity threats and fraud attempts necessitate robust protective measures.
- Responsible Gambling: Operators must implement tools to prevent addiction and promote safe gambling habits.
- Market Saturation: Increasing competition demands innovation and differentiation to retain players.
Comparing Online Casino Software Providers
The choice of software provider significantly influences the quality and variety of games offered by an online casino. Below is a comparison of some leading providers in the market:
| Provider | Game Variety | Mobile Compatibility | Security Features | Unique Selling Point |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| NetEnt | Slots, Table Games, Live Casino | Excellent | High-level encryption | Innovative graphics and gameplay |
| Microgaming | Slots, Progressive Jackpots, Poker | Very Good | Certified RNG | Largest progressive jackpot network |
| Evolution Gaming | Live Dealer Games | Excellent | Secure streaming | Leader in live casino solutions |
| Playtech | Slots, Table Games, Sportsbook | Good | Advanced fraud detection | Comprehensive product portfolio |
Future Outlook: What to Expect in Online Gambling
The future of online casinos is promising, with several emerging trends poised to redefine the player experience and industry standards.
- Virtual Reality Casinos: Immersive VR environments will offer players a realistic casino atmosphere from their homes.
- AI-Powered Customer Support: Enhanced chatbots and AI assistants will provide instant, personalized assistance.
- Blockchain Transparency: Decentralized ledgers will ensure fairness and traceability of transactions.
- Esports Betting Integration: The rise of esports will open new betting markets within online casinos.
- Enhanced Regulatory Cooperation: International collaboration may lead to standardized regulations, simplifying compliance.
